He is the brother of the Qatari international player Saoud Ghanem .
Mohamed Ghanem was born in Kuwait and he is a Bidoon, started his career at Al-Arabi and is a product of the Arabi's youth system, and he played with them until 2013 .[4]
On 15 September 2015, he obtained the Qatari passport and signed with Mesaimeer .[5] On 6 March 2016, Mohamed Ghanem made his professional debut for Mesaimeer against El Jaish in the Pro League .[6]
On 5 July 2019, he left Mesaimeer and signed with Qatar on loan of the season.[7]
